Slow-Cooker Chuck Roast with Potatoes & Carrots
Webb1 maj 2024 · Add ingredients. Place frozen roast in a slow cooker. Add cup of broth on the top. In a small bowl combine all the seasonings, then sprinkle on top of meat. Cook. Then cook on high setting and cook for 6 hours, until meat is fork tender. If you want to add vegetables, add them 1 hour before the end of the cook time.
